Beijing: Unveiling the Imperial Capital
Start your journey in the bustling heart of Beijing, where the Forbidden City, once the exclusive domain of emperors, invites you to step back in time. Explore the vast Tiananmen Square, marvel at the Temple of Heaven's intricate architecture, and climb the Jinshanling Great Wall to witness its awe-inspiring grandeur.
Xi'an: Embracing History and Culture
Journey west to Xi'an, the former capital of the Tang Dynasty. Delve into the enigmatic world of the Terracotta Warriors, standing tall as silent guardians in their subterranean mausoleum. Visit the Big Wild Goose Pagoda, a testament to Buddhist heritage, and wander through the bustling Muslim Quarter, where vibrant street life and tantalizing aromas entice.
Shanghai: A Modern Metropolis on the Huangpu
Venture east to Shanghai, a thriving metropolis where towering skyscrapers pierce the skyline. Admire the Bund, a picturesque waterfront boulevard, and ascend the Shanghai Tower for breathtaking panoramic views. Explore the bustling markets and alleys of Nanjing Road, where modernity and tradition collide.
Zhangjiajie: Nature's Majestic Art
Escape to the ethereal landscapes of Zhangjiajie,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Ascend Tianzi Mountain to witness the iconic pillars of quartz sandstone that rise like celestial spires. Hike through Avatar Hallelujah Mountain, and marvel at the surreal beauty that inspired the blockbuster film.
Guilin: Serenity Amidst Karst Mountains
Journey further south to Guilin, a city nestled amidst a breathtaking landscape of karst mountains and winding rivers. Embark on a tranquil Li River cruise, where towering peaks and lush vegetation create a picturesque canvas. Explore the Reed Flute Cave, an underground wonderland adorned with intricate stalactites and stalagmites.
Hangzhou: A Poetic Lakeside Retreat
Continue east to Hangzhou, a city renowned for its natural beauty. Stroll along West Lake,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, where ancient pagodas and picturesque gardens harmoniously blend. Visit the Lingyin Temple, a centuries-old Buddhist sanctuary nestled among the rolling hills.
Suzhou: Venice of the East
Journey east to Suzhou, the charming "Venice of the East." Explore the city's intricate canals and bridges, and wander through the Humble Administrator's Garden, a masterpiece of Chinese landscaping. Admire the Suzhou Embroidery Research Institute to witness the繊細 artistry of this ancient craft.
Nanjing: The Ancient Capital of the South
Head northwest to Nanjing, the former capital of the Ming Dynasty. Visit the magnificent Nanjing City Wall, one of the best-preserved city walls in China. Explore the Sun Yat-sen Mausoleum, a towering monument to the father of modern China, and delve into the Nanjing Massacre Memorial to reflect on its tragic past.
Datong: Exploring Cave Temples
Venture north to Datong, a city renowned for its numerous cave temples. Explore the Yungang Grottoes,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, where thousands of Buddhist sculptures adorn the walls of over 200 caves. Visit the Hanging Temple, precariously perched on a cliff face, and marvel at its architectural ingenuity.
Harbin: Ice and Snow Wonderland
As you approach the northernmost point of your journey, visit Harbin, a city known for its enchanting winter wonderland. During the Harbin International Ice and Snow Festival, admire awe-inspiring ice sculptures and snow creations that transform the city into a magical realm.
